Join W.A. Franke Honors College professor Patrick Baliani and alumna Mireya Borgen (MA Literature ‘25) for an interactive tour and discussion of the exhibition Bailey Doogan: Ways of Seeing.

Explore themes and significant periods in Doogan’s artistic life through observation, reflection and conversation. Space is limited; arrive on time to secure your spot.

Professor and playwright Patrick Baliani, MFA, teaches Interdisciplinary Studies at the W.A. Franke Honors College. He has produced original plays, translations and literary adaptations at The Rogue Theatre, as well as nationally and in Canada. He frequently brings his courses to learn in the UAMA galleries. On Thursday, April 2, join us again from 11:00 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. to hear short talks by students in Baliani's course "Art and Anatomy," who will further explore the work of Bailey Doogan.

Mireya Borgen is a W.A. Franke Honors College alumni (BA in English and Political Science, MA in Literature). Mireya is enamored with learning about and teaching visual arts, which has profoundly influenced her decision to continue studying literature as well as her future aspirations to teach in the field. Previously at UAMA, Mireya performed alongside Professor Baliani and student Nicholas Owen in a reading of John Logan’s play “Red” about the life and work of American abstract painter Mark Rothko.
